CHEESECAKE CUPCAKES
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ories dessert
Time 2h10m
Yield 24 cupcakes
Number Of Ingredients 26
Steps:
- For the crust: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line two 12-cup standard muffin tins with paper liners.
- Combine the graham cracker crumbs, granulated sugar, cinnamon and butter in a small bowl. Drop a heaping tablespoon of graham cracker mixture into each muffin cup. Press to create a firm layer of crust on the bottom. Bake 7 minutes. Set aside to cool completely.
- For the cupcakes: Combine the flour, baking powder, baking soda and salt in a medium bowl.
- Using a hand mixer or stand mixer, cream the butter and granulated sugar together until fluffy, 2 to 3 minutes. Add the eggs, one at a time, scraping down the bowl between additions. Beat in the vanilla.
- Whisk together the sour cream and the milk. Add the flour mixture and milk mixture in three additions, alternating between wet and dry ingredients and starting and ending with flour mixture. Beat just until well combined, taking care not to overmix.
- For the filling: Beat the cream cheese and granulated sugar in a bowl with an electric mixer at medium speed until light and fluffy, about 3 minutes. Beat in the egg just until combined. Spoon the filling into a pastry bag fitted with a medium-size plain tip (Ateco 800). Insert the tip into the top of each cupcake batter and squeeze the filling until the batter rises to fill each cup about three-quarters of the way up the side of the tin.
- Bake until lightly golden and a toothpick inserted about 3/4 inch from the edge of the cupcakes comes out clean, 18 to 20 minutes. Cool the cupcakes in the tins on a rack for 10 minutes, and then remove from the tins and cool completely.
- For the frosting: Using an electric or stand mixer, beat the cream cheese and butter together at medium speed until fluffy, about 2 minutes. Scrape down the sides of the bowl. Beat in the sour cream and lemon juice. On low speed, gradually add the confectioners' sugar and beat until well combined.
- Frost the cupcakes as desired. Garnish with graham cracker pieces.
CHEESECAKE CUPCAKES
Cute little cheesecakes topped with strawberry-flavored rainbow chip frosting. Oh so yummy!
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Dessert
Time 3h30m
Yield 18
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Heat oven to 325°F. Place paper baking cup in each of 18 regular-size muffin cups; lightly spray paper cups with cooking spray. In small bowl, mix Crust ingredients. Spoon evenly into muffin cups; press down slightly.
- In large bowl, beat cream cheese, 1/2 cup sugar and the vanilla with electric mixer on medium speed until blended. Beat in eggs, one at a time, just until blended. Spoon filling evenly into muffin cups, filling each about three-fourths full.
- Bake 24 to 26 minutes or until filling is set. Cool 10 minutes; remove from pan to cooling rack. Cool completely, about 30 minutes.
- In small bowl, mix fruit spread and frosting; spread over cupcakes. Refrigerate about 2 hours. Garnish each with small strawberry half.

CHEESECAKE STUFFED CHOCOLATE CUPCAKES RECIPE - (4.3/5)
Provided by mzander
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- CUPCAKES: Preheat the oven to 350°F. Line two standard muffin tins with 16 paper liners. Place 1/2 cup of the chocolate chips in a small microwave-safe bowl and microwave on high for 45 seconds. Stir until smooth. If not completely melted, return to the microwave for 10 second bursts until smooth. Let cool. In a medium bowl combine the flour, baking soda, and salt. In a large bowl vigorously whisk the sugar, oil, egg, and vanilla until well combined. Beat in the melted chocolate chips. Gradually add the flour mixture alternatively with the water. The batter will be thin. FILLING: In the bowl of an electric mixer beat the cream cheese, sugar, egg, and salt until creamy. Stir in 1 cup of the chocolate chips. Fill each muffin cup half full. Spoon a tablespoon of the cream cheese filling over the batter. Spoon the remaining batter over the cream cheese filling. Bake for 20 to 25 minutes, or until a cake tester inserted in the center comes out clean. While still hot, sprinkle the remaining 1/2 cup chocolate chips onto the cupcakes. Let cool for 5 minutes, or until the chocolate chips are shiny, then spread to frost. Remove to wire racks to cool completely.

LEMON CHEESECAKE CUPCAKE
Steps:
- For the graham cracker crumbs: In small b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s and butter and stir. Set aside.
- For the cheesecake filling: Using an electric mixer, beat the cream cheese and confectioners' sugar for 3 minutes. Beat in the vanilla and egg white until smooth and creamy. Set aside.
- For the cake batter: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F; line cupcake pans with 12 cupcake liners.
- In a medium bowl, combine the pastry flour, baking powder and salt and set aside. Using an electric mixer with a paddle attachment, cream the sugar, butter and cream cheese on medium speed until light and fluffy. Add the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. Add the lemon juice, limoncello and lemon zest and mix until incorporated. On low speed, add the flour mixture and buttermilk alternately, beginning and ending with the flour.
- Sprinkle 1 tablespoon of the graham cracker crumbs in the bottom of each liner, fill about halfway with the cake batter and top with the cheesecake filling. Bake until an inserted toothpick comes out clean, 25 minutes.
- For the buttercream frosting: In the bowl of an electric mixer with a paddle attachment, beat the butter and shortening on medium speed until light and fluffy. Add the almond and lemon flavorings and beat for 2 minutes. Add the confectioners' sugar one cup at a time, alternating with 1/4 cup water, and beat until incorporated.
- Top each cupcake with some of the buttercream frosting.

EASY CHEESECAKE-FILLED CUPCAKES (VEGAN)
I veganized an old family recipe and it was a huge success. These are classic chocolate cupcakes with a chocolate chip cheesecake center. Popular with omnivores, as well as vegans!
Provided by Emily Kennedy
Time 1h5m
Yield 18
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line 18 muffin cups with paper liners.
- Combine flour, sugar, cocoa, baking soda, and salt for cupcakes together in a bowl. Add water, oil, vinegar, and vanilla and beat until combined; be careful not to overmix.
- Beat vegan cream cheese and sugar for filling together in a separate bowl until smooth. Add vegan yogurt, cornstarch, vanilla, and salt and beat until combined. Fold in chocolate chips.
- Fill each prepared muffin cup 2/3 full with chocolate batter. Spoon a heaping tablespoon of the cream cheese mixture on top of the chocolate batter. Sprinkle the remaining sugar on top.
- Bake in the preheated oven until both the cake and filling appear set, about 20 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ool completely, about 30 minutes; these taste best when completely cooled.
